Job summary

FedEx Freight is seeking a leadership-oriented supervisor in Charlotte, NC to guide warehouse and dock teams to deliver shipments on time and damage-free. The role focuses on safety, efficiency, and customer satisfaction while coaching employees for retention and growth.

The candidate will plan daily manpower, assign tasks, monitor performance, and coordinate with service center partners to meet service standards. Experience in LTL and DOT regulations is valued.

Job description

POSITION OVERVIEW

Lead employees to ensure customer satisfaction by moving all shipments on time and damage free.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
  • Lead, manage, educate and develop company employees focusing on retention and growth
  • Supervise and direct employee work (including pre-shifts) with a focus on outstanding quality, customer deliverables and safety performance identifying and overseeing improvement
  • Actively monitor, record and educate employees regarding unsafe acts/conditions correcting immediately using corrective action as need. Provide feedback and follow-up with all impacted employees.
  • Plan daily manpower needs and set schedules to ensure customers’ freight is delivered and picked-up timely and damage free
  • Communicate job assignments coordinating with all employees ensuring direction is clear and concise
  • Monitor service freight and ensure cut time compliance
  • Monitor, analyze and address all opportunities to cut costs and improve efficiencies while maintaining rigorous safety standards
  • Assist customers with rate quotes, claim information and setting appointments
  • Monitor actual performance data and gather information for reporting
  • Build relationships and positive communications with all business partners to ensure customers’ and company’s service standards are met
  • Identify freight moving at incorrect weight and classification
  • Ensure all OS&D is identified and processed properly
  • Perform administrative functions as required
  • Comply with all applicable laws/regulations, as well as company policies/procedures
  • Perform other duties as required

WORKING CONDITIONS
  • Dock environment; exposure to varied weather conditions, exhaust, fumes, dust, noise
  • Hours may vary due to operational need
  • Frequent contact with service center personnel; fast-paced, deadline oriented
